R. Lee Ermey, born on March 24, 1944, in Emporia, Kansas, was a formidable figure known for his captivating portrayal of tough military characters, particularly in his iconic role as Gunnery Sergeant Hartman in "Full Metal Jacket." A former Marine drill instructor, Ermey's authenticity and commanding presence on screen set him apart in Hollywood. Beyond acting, he was a dedicated advocate for veterans and a beloved host of programs like "Mail Call," leaving a lasting legacy that intertwined military authenticity with engaging entertainment.
